About Yi‐Xin Zeng

Yi‐Xin Zeng is a scholar working on Oncology, Cancer Research and Otorhinolaryngology, having authored 188 papers that have together received 7.8k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Viral-associated cancers and disorders (42 papers), RNA modifications and cancer (26 papers), Cancer-related Molecular Pathways (18 papers), Cancer-related gene regulation (15 papers), Lymphoma Diagnosis and Treatment (14 papers), Cancer-related molecular mechanisms research (14 papers), Cancer Genomics and Diagnostics (13 papers) and Immune Cell Function and Interaction (13 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Otorhinolaryngology (546 citations), Cancer Research (1.7k citations) and Oncology (2.7k citations). Yi‐Xin Zeng has collaborated with scholars based in China, United States and Hong Kong. Frequent co-authors include Gonghuan Yang, Xia Wan, Maigeng Zhou, Haidong Wang, George F. Gao, Yuhong Jiang, Christopher J L Murray, Shicheng Yu, Alan D López and Mohsen Naghavi. Their work appears in journals such as Nature,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ences and The Lancet.
